select语句查询最高工资

来源:百度知道 编辑:UC知道 时间:2024/09/28 08:45:01
需要用到子查询,不能使用max

select top 1 工资 from 工资表 order by 工资 DESC
在工资表中查询一条记录,按工资降序排列!可以实现吧?

select max(工资) from 工资表
也可以实现吧,利用统计方法!多了去了!

为什么要用子查询?根本不用的,干嘛用子查询?

是不是所有信息?
select * from 工资表 where 工资= selectselect top 1 工资 from 工资表 order by 工资 DESC

select * from 工资表 where 工资=select max(工资) from 工资表

这样吗?SQL用这种用法的话,真是。。。。
一句能完成决不用两句,一个查询能完成决不用两个! 难道是较复杂越喜欢不成?